Pilot dies after serious helicopter crash in NSW
A man has died three days after the helicopter he was flying ploughed into powerlines in southern NSW.
Emergency crews were called to a property on Carrathool Road in Conargo shortly after 11am on Friday, following reports of a serious helicopter crash.
Upon arrival, the male pilot was pulled from the wreckage of the chopper after becoming trapped inside following the crash.
The 34-year-old from Griffith was treated on scene by paramedics before being flown to Royal Melbourne Hospital in a critical condition.
Sadly, police have confirmed the man passed away in hospital earlier this morning.
The crash site remains under the control of the Australian Transport Safety Bureau.
